The Invasion of Waikato was an invasion during the
New Zealand Wars fought in the
North Island of
New Zealand from July
1863 to April
1864 between the military forces of the Colonial Government and a federation of
Māori tribes known as the
King Movement (Kingitanga). Initiated by a hostile Government, it ended with the retreat of the Kingites into the rugged interior of the island and the confiscation of about 12,000 km² of Māori land.
